Trichloroacetic acid (CCl3COOH) is a corrosive acid that is used to precipitate proteins. Acute (short-term) inhalation or dermal exposure may irritate or cause severe damage to the skin, eyes, respiratory tract, and mucous membranes and cause depression of the central nervous system in humans. When we compare these values with those of comparable alcohols, such as ethanol (pK a = 16) and 2-methyl-2-propanol (pK a = 19), it is clear that carboxylic acids are stronger acids by over ten powers of ten! This is because the electronegative halogen atoms delocalizes the negative charge on the carboxylate anion, which stabilizes the conjugate base, and the more electronegative the halogen the greater this stabilization becomes. In general, the more stabilized the negative charge of the conjugate base is, the more the equilibrium favors that form, thus the more the acid dissociates, thus the "stronger" the acid is.39 g/mol Chemical Formula: CCl₃COOH Hill Formula: C₂HCl₃O₂ Grade: ACS,Reag. The seven common strong acids are: #"HClO"_4 Trichloroacetic acid (TCA; TCAA; also known as trichloroethanoic acid) is an analogue of acetic acid in which the three hydrogen atoms of the methyl group have all been replaced by chlorine atoms.
